The England I Knew
The England I knew When I came to England in the seventies, I settled in a dreadful town called Elsmere Port the saving grace, it had a library and was near Chester and Liverpool. My education was a woeful lacking substance I took classes in counselling, philosophy, literature and of all thing acting, an art that always has fascinated me. The chasm between workers and bosses was not deep even the Tory party had a human face Then came the catastrophe, in the form of a female called Margarete Thatcher. Greed is right; there is no society, and workers were encouraged to buy their council homes and social housing virtually stopped. Factories closed “get on your bike” was the mantra England stopped being a pleasant place to live. It got worse; BREXIT came and tore Britain apart people had been seduced to think it was patriotic to vote for Brexit. (To take the country back) The decline is for all to see, foodbanks and poverty among riches, and it was with sorrow I saw the once fine nation falls into cynicism. and the murder of NHS, a pearl in a tattered crown
